The CGT on Tuesday launched a call for a renewable strike by garbage collectors and "the
entire waste industry
" from the national day of action on March 7 against the pension reform project and the two-year postponement. of the legal retirement age.

"
The CGT federations of public services and transport call (...) in all companies, public establishments and communities to meet (...) to prepare for the strike in the sectors of waste and household waste collection, sorting and processing of waste, from March 7 and until the withdrawal of the bill
”, they indicate in a joint press release.
In Paris, the CGT is the majority.
